REQUEST FOR EXPRESSIONS OF INTEREST
AFRICAN DEVELOPMENT BANK
PREPARATION OF BANK GROUP’S FULL-FLEDGED STRATEGIES FOR THE DEVELOPMENT OF AFRICA’S QUALITY HEALTH INFRASTRUCTURE AND DEVELOPMENT OF AFRICA’S PHARMACEUTICAL INDUSTRY
Abidjan – Cote d’Ivoire
- The African Development Bank hereby invites Consultancy Firms to express their interest in the following assignment: PREPARATION OF BANK GROUP’S FULL-FLEDGED STRATEGIES FOR AFRICA’S QUALITY HEALTH INFRASTRUCTURE SUPPORT STRATEGY AND AFRICA’S PHARMACEUTICAL INDUSTRY SUPPORT STRATEGY ;
- The services to be provided under the assignment span two distinct workstreams; namely, (1) Health Infrastructure Strategy and (2) Pharmaceutical Industry Strategy. The AfDB is keen to engage a successful Consultancy Firm between July and October 2020 to deliver the following services covering the two workstreams. Interested firms should submit Expressions of Interest to undertake both workstreams.

- The Human Capital, Youth and Skills Development Department will be supervising Workstream 1. The Industrial and Trade Development Department will be supervising Workstream 2. The two Bank’s departments are now inviting eligible Consulting Firms to express their interest in providing services in relation to the required Assignment. Interested Firms must provide information indicating that they are qualified to perform the services (registration documents of the firm, brochures, detailed description of similar assignments, experience in similar conditions, availability of appropriate skills among staff relevant to the assignment, approach followed in previous similar assignments specifically relating to the study component as well as implementation etc.). Consulting Firms may constitute joint ventures to enhance their chances of qualification ;
- Interested Firms are expected to have a demonstrable track record of experience in the social development and industrial development sectors including advisory support, sector analyses, reform programmes’ design and implementation and or related studies and assignments, development of economic and financial models for the health systems and health infrastructure, industrial development, pharmaceutical industry development, sector policy review, regulatory review, market analyses on the African continent or similar jurisdictions. A demonstrated Africa experience dealing with government agencies will be an added advantage ;
- The expressions of interest should have the following format and will be scored on the above-mentioned criteria :
- Details of the Consulting Firm or consortium of Consulting Firms (including where company is headquartered and history of operations) ;
- Expression of Interest detailing strengths, expertise, approach and any information focusing on the above information ;
- Any additional document /section you believe to be relevant.
- Eligibility criteria, establishment of the short-list and the selection procedure shall be in accordance with the Bank’s “Rules and Procedures for the use of Consultants”. Please note that interest expressed by a Consultancy Firm does not imply any obligation on the part of the Bank to include the firm in the shortlist ;
- The duration of the proposed contract is 5 months. The Commencement Date is anticipated to be 01 July 2020 ;
